Choose a color palette

Staying in the same color palette helps tie everything together and make it look cohesive. Even if you have a lot of stuff out on display (even though I’m personally more minimal, I absolutely love cozy maximalist desk setups!), a color palette will help it all look intentional rather than thrown together.

For me, I chose a black, white, and grey palette (surprise, surprise!). That meant trying to choose and display objects that were those colors in addition to being functional. That’s why the linen grey box, grey ceramic dish, marble dish, and even the silver phone stand and computer go together pretty well: they’re all really part of that same color family.

I like to have some pops of color, like in my desk calendar or having pastel markers on hand in a frosted pencil cup.

If you feel like you have too much color, try grouping things by color instead, either in rainbow formation or just by the same colors. That can also help make everything look intentional!

Give everything its own space

This also helps everything look tidy, too. If you have a space for everything then it won’t look too cluttered visually, which makes your desk look minimal and tidy.

One of my favorite ways to do this was with the magazine organizer I found on Amazon. I use it for my iPad, bullet journals, Hobonichi, and work binder, as well as for any mail or other ephemera I need to go through (kind of like an inbox). Rather than keep these books in a stack, or even within bookends, I like the magazine holder because nothing falls down and it all stays straight up and well supported. Use hidden storage

My best tip: hidden storage!! I got this box at a Homegoods, where you can find plenty of decorative storage boxes, or you might even save gift boxes too. I used to have things like extra wires, hair ties, coasters, or lip balms out on my desk or in a clear drawer but sometimes that’s unsightly or doesn’t match a color scheme. Popping it all into this box means it’s handy, doesn’t take up a lot of visual space, and all the things I need are still right there… like my charging cord for my Kindle that always runs out at the worst moments.
